Dimensions at widest points approximately 90 mm x 80 mm x 25 mm thick. Weighs: 412 grams From the Cleaverville Formation, Ord Ranges near Port Hedland, Western Australia. Age is over 3 billion years. Tiger iron is a banded iron formation (BIF) or jaspilite that has alternating layers of black and brown hematite magnetite,
